Explains ethical principles and their importance in society. Demonstrates a full understanding of how ethical principles are derived and why they matter and offers examples of their own incorporation of the principles and/or viably serves as an exemplar response that could be used in future renditions of the course. In short the evaluator determines that not only does a student ‘get it’, they embrace it and enact it. Demonstrates a full understanding of ethical principles and their importance in society. Uses knowledge, theories, and analysis to clarify how an ethical principle or principles are derived and explain why that principle (those principles) matter(s) Shows a clear but incomplete understanding of ethical principles and their importance in society. Explains how an ethical principle is derived, but leaves out why it is important or explains why it matters but not how it is grounded or supported. Shows little or no evidence of understanding what ethical principles. Responses show little or no use of knowledge, theories, and/or analysis to be able to explain how ethics are supported or why they are important.
